Concrete foundation repair services focus on restoring the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the extent of damage, identifying underlying issues such as settling, cracking, or shifting,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, slab jacking, piering, and crack injection, all aimed at reinforcing the foundation and preventing further deterioration. The goal is to ensure that the foundation can safely support the structure above, reducing the risk of future problems and maintaining the property’s overall stability.
Foundation problems can cause a range of issues within a property,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or walls. Over time, these issues may worsen if left unaddressed, leading to structural instability and costly repairs. Repairing the foundation helps to correct these problems, improve safety, and prevent further damage. Addressing foundation concerns early can also protect other parts of the property, such as plumbing and electrical systems, which may be affected by shifting or settling.
Various types of properties utilize concrete foundation repair services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Homes with basements or crawl spaces are particularly susceptible to foundation issues, especially in areas with expansive soil or significant moisture fluctuations. Commercial properties, such as retail stores or office buildings, may also require foundation repairs to maintain structural safety and comply with building codes. Regardless of property type, professional assessment and repair are essential to ensure long-term stability and safety.

Cost Range for Repairs -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air services varies based on the extent of damage. For minor cracks and small repairs, prices usually start around $1,000. Larger, more extensive repairs can cost upwards of $10,000 or more.
Average Pricing Factors - Factors influencing costs include the size of the foundation, severity of issues, and repair methods used. Expect to see typical project costs fall between $3,000 and $8,000 for moderate repairs in the Plano, IL area.
Cost Variability - Costs can fluctuate depending on the complexity of the repair and accessibility of the foundation. Some projects may be as low as $2,000, while more complicated cases could reach $15,000 or higher.
Service Cost Estimates - Local pros typically provide cost estimates based on the specific foundation issues encountered. Contacting a professional for an assessment can help determine a more precise price within the typical range of $2,500 to $12,000.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a concrete foundation need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ks, uneven floors, doors or windows that stick, and settling or shifting of the structure.
How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days.
Can foundation issues be fixed without extensive excavation? Some minor problems may be addressed with less invasive methods, but more significant issues often require excavation and reinforcement.
What factors influence the cost of foundation repair services? Costs depend on the severity of damage, repair methods used, and the size of the affected area.
